AI adoption among businesses in Saudi Arabia reached 33.1 percent in 2025, according to the General Authority of Statistics of Saudi Arabia (GASTAT). One in three Saudi businesses is actively using AI in daily operations right now, which means successful businesses aren’t experimenting with AI anymore. AI runs in their daily operations, helping them make better decisions, improve productivity, and reduce repetitive tasks.
The question for Saudi business owners has moved on from whether to use AI. Now it’s about applying it correctly: integrating it into the systems and making sure it is implemented effectively to generate better results.

What Business Owners Get Wrong About AI Implementation
AI is not a product you buy; it is a capability you build. Most people get this wrong early, treating AI the way they would treat any other piece of software: pay for it, log in, and expect results from day one.
AI on its own doesn’t know your business. It has no idea what your inventory system looks like, how your approval chain works, or which numbers actually signal a problem. That gap only closes through proper AI development, connecting it to your systems, training it on your actual data, and building it around how your business runs.

The AI Implementation Process: Stage by Stage

| Stage | What Happens |
| 1. Business Audit | Maps the operational problem before any tool is chosen |
| 2. System Connection | Integrates with existing ERP, CRM, and databases |
| 3. Pilot Deployment | Tests with real data, real users, real conditions |
| 4. Scaling | Rolls out with defined ownership and monitoring at each phase |
1. Business Audit and Problem Definition
Every AI implementation that delivers real results starts the same way: mapping the operational problem before picking any technology. Start by finding where the workflow is actually breaking down: the inefficiency, the error, the decision that’s taking too long. Map what data exists, where it sits, and how good it actually is. If you skip this step and jump straight to tool selection, you get a system that technically works but never solves the actual problem.
2. System Integration and Data Connection
AI does not replace existing systems. It integrates with them, connecting to your ERP, your CRM, and your internal databases and giving those systems the intelligence they weren’t built with. The quality of that integration decides the quality of the output. An AI forecasting system connected to incomplete inventory data produces bad forecasts. An AI customer service system that can’t see live order status gives answers that sound right but are useless.
Bad data is the most common reason AI projects underperform. Fix data quality before you go live, not after. That’s what separates AI that actually delivers from AI that needs months of cleanup once it’s already running.
3. Pilot Deployment and Validation
Start with a controlled pilot before scaling. It lets you measure real performance against the success criteria you defined during scoping, with real data, real users, and real operating conditions, not the clean environment of a demo. The pilot shows you where the system breaks in production versus how it looked in testing. Fix those gaps at the pilot stage. It costs far less than fixing them after you’ve rolled the system out to the whole business.
4. Scaling and Rollout
Most AI implementations don’t fail because the technology can’t keep up; they fail because nobody planned the scale-up properly. What worked well for one workflow in one department runs into different data quality, different edge cases, and different user habits once it’s rolled out across the whole business. Scaling it properly takes a real expansion plan: a defined rollout order, clear ownership at each phase, data standards that hold across every system involved, and monitoring that tracks how things are actually going at each stage instead of just assuming the pilot’s results will repeat themselves.
Saudi AI Regulatory Requirements Every Business Must Meet
SDAIA and PDPL: What the Saudi Data Protection Law Means for AI
Saudi Arabia’s Personal Data Protection Law (PDPL), administered by SDAIA, defines how personal data can be collected, stored, processed, and used by AI systems. For any AI application handling customer data, employee data, or patient data, PDPL compliance is not optional.
Compliance requirements affect how data is sourced and consented to, how long it is retained, how it is secured, and what rights individuals have over how their data is used.
AI systems that weren’t built for PDPL compliance from the start need structural changes later, and those changes can be expensive.
ZATCA, SAMA, and SFDA: Where AI Touches Regulated Functions
AI systems that interact with financial transactions, healthcare data, or food and pharmaceutical processes operate within regulatory frameworks that carry specific technical requirements.
ZATCA e-invoicing compliance affects any AI system that processes or generates financial documents: invoice extraction, automated billing, and financial workflow automation all need to produce ZATCA-compliant output.
SAMA requirements govern AI systems used in financial services, FinTech applications, and banking: transaction logic, fraud detection systems, and customer data handling must all meet SAMA’s regulatory standards.
SFDA touchpoints apply to AI systems used in pharmaceutical and food sector operations where regulatory reporting is required.
These requirements need to be built into the system architecture from the start. Retrofitting compliance into a live AI system is expensive, time-consuming, and disruptive to operations that are already depending on the system.
Data Residency and Cloud Infrastructure for AI
NDMO data residency requirements affect where certain categories of Saudi data can be stored and processed. For AI systems handling personal data, financial data, or data classified under Saudi national data frameworks, the hosting infrastructure needs to be selected with data residency compliance in mind.
Major cloud providers, including AWS and Microsoft Azure, operate Saudi regional infrastructure that satisfies data residency requirements for most business AI applications. The right infrastructure choice depends on the data classification requirements of the specific AI use case, the latency requirements of the application, and the compliance obligations of the industry sector.
What AI Integration Actually Costs in Saudi Arabia

Cost in artificial intelligence development is driven by the complexity of the operational problem, the quality and accessibility of the data the system needs to work with, and the number of existing systems the AI needs to integrate with. There is no fixed price for AI, and any quote produced without a detailed operational audit is not a reliable number.
Departmental AI Integration
The lowest cost tier in AI development services. A focused implementation targeting one workflow, document processing, customer query handling, demand forecasting for a single product category. Appropriate for Saudi businesses starting with a defined, bounded problem before committing to broader AI transformation.
Cross-System AI Integration
More expensive due to the integration complexity involved in connecting AI across existing ERP, CRM, and operational systems. The data preparation and system integration work often exceeds the AI model development work at this tier. This is where most mid-sized Saudi businesses sit when implementing AI for business operations at scale.
Enterprise AI Deployment
The highest cost tier. Custom model training on proprietary business data, integration across multiple enterprise systems, Arabic language model development, and compliance architecture for regulated industries. Enterprise artificial intelligence development for Saudi businesses in financial services, healthcare, and large-scale retail sits at this level.

Common Mistakes Saudi Businesses Make When Implementing AI

Selecting Tools Before Defining the Problem
Tools selected before problems are defined consistently produce implementations that solve the wrong thing efficiently. The AI works as specified. The specification was wrong. Restarting after go-live costs more than getting the brief right.
Using Incomplete or Poor-Quality Data
AI output quality is a direct function of input data quality. Businesses that deploy AI on top of fragmented, inconsistent, or incomplete data get fragmented, inconsistent, and incomplete outputs, and often blame the AI rather than the data infrastructure underneath it.
Running Pilots With No Scaling Plan
A successful pilot that was never intended to scale is a demonstration, not an implementation. AI for business processes only delivers commercial return when it operates at scale. Pilots without defined scaling criteria and expansion plans produce insight without impact.
Ignoring Arabic Language Requirements
Roll out AI for a Saudi workforce or Saudi customers without real Arabic language capability, dedicated NLP, not a translation layer stapled on, and you end up with a system the people it’s meant for don’t trust and won’t use.
Treating AI as a One-Time Project
Data shifts, business processes evolve, regulations change, and the AI needs to keep pace with all of it. Treat a deployment as finished the day it goes live, and performance quietly erodes as the system falls further out of step with what’s actually happening in the business.

What does Saudi Arabia’s PDPL mean for businesses using AI?
The Personal Data Protection Law requires that personal data used by AI systems is collected with consent, stored securely, used only for defined purposes, and subject to individual access and deletion rights. For AI systems handling customer data, patient data, or employee data, PDPL compliance must be built into the data architecture from the start — it is not a compliance review conducted after the system is already processing data.

What is the difference between using AI for business intelligence and standard business reporting?
Standard business reporting tells you what happened. AI powered business intelligence tells you what is likely to happen next and why. The difference is not just speed — it is the ability to identify non-obvious patterns across large datasets that inform decisions before outcomes occur rather than after. For Saudi businesses where demand is seasonal, customer behavior is variable, and operational complexity is high, that forward-looking capability is the practical value of AI business intelligence over standard reporting.
